WebHere, both state.a and state.b will trigger a refetch, despite b is not passed to the async fetch function. const asyncSomething = useAsync(() => fetchSomething(state.a), [ state.a, state.b, ]); Here, only state.a will trigger a refetch, despite b being passed to the async fetch function. WebFeb 7, 2024 · Using auto refetching in React Query. To use the auto refetch mode, you can pass an optional parameter to the React Query hook called refetchInterval. The value is in milliseconds. The above example will query the random data API and ask for a random vehicle. This call will refetch the data every 6000 milliseconds.
Fetch, Cache, and Update Data Effortlessly with React Query
WebFeb 9, 2024 · Seems like the promise returned by refetch is resolved after the refetch is finished, which means this can be used as a temporary workaround for determining if a query is being fetched or not. Edit 2: When using refetch while loading is true, the promise of refetch will never resolve nor reject. I will also try to take a look at the code on the ... WebNov 13, 2024 · 2 Answers. You can use your criteria as query key. Whenever a query's key changes, the query will automatically update. const FetchPosts = async ( {criteria}) => { console.log (criteria) //from useQuery key //your get api call here with criteria params … ionization of phosphoric acid
Pierre Criulanscy on LinkedIn: Bon j'ai un vrai coup de gueule …
Webrestful-react import --file MY_OPENAPI_SPEC.yaml --output my-awesome-generated-types.tsx. This command can be invoked by either: Installing restful-react globally and running it in the terminal: npm i -g restful-react, or. Adding a … WebHow do I make React Query fetch on click? Reading through their docs, they say the way to do things is to abstract their useQuery object into a custom hook. So my hooks file looks like: // Get the user const { data: user } = useQuery ( ['user', email], getUserByEmail) const userId = user?.id // Then get the user's projects const { isIdle, data ... WebThe query will not automatically refetch in the background. The query will ignore query client invalidateQueries and refetchQueries calls that would normally result in the query refetching. refetch returned from useQuery can be used to manually trigger the query to fetch. tsx function Todos() { ionization potential of na